NVIDIA PhysX Software
Introduction
NVIDIA PhysX is a powerful physics engine which enables real-time physics in leading edge PC and console games. PhysX software is widely adopted by over 150 games and is used by more than 10,000 developers. PhysX is designed specifically for hardware acceleration by powerful processors with hundreds of cores.
Features
• Rigid Body Simulation – PhysX allows developers to create realistic object interaction with full rigid body dynamics. This includes rigid body objects, rigid body constraints, and rigid body particles.
• Character Controller – PhysX provides a complete character controller package which allows developers to create realistic character motion. This includes character movement, character interaction with the environment, and character interaction with other characters.
• Soft Body Simulation – PhysX provides a complete soft body simulation package which allows developers to create realistic deformable objects. This includes cloth, soft bodies, and deformable terrain.
• Fluid Simulation – PhysX provides a complete fluid simulation package which allows developers to create realistic liquid effects. This includes water, smoke, and fire.
• Particle System – PhysX provides a complete particle system package which allows developers to create realistic particle effects. This includes explosions, sparks, and dust.
• Collision Detection – PhysX provides a complete collision detection package which allows developers to create realistic interactions between objects. This includes collision detection between rigid bodies, soft bodies, and particles.
• Constraint Solver – PhysX provides a complete constraint solver package which allows developers to create realistic constraints between objects. This includes spring, motor, and servo constraints.
• Behavioral Simulation – PhysX provides a complete behavioral simulation package which allows developers to create realistic behaviors for objects. This includes locomotion, pathfinding, and crowd simulation.
• Cloth and Hair Simulation – PhysX provides a complete cloth and hair simulation package which allows developers to create realistic cloth and hair effects. This includes cloth, fur, and hair.
• Optimization – PhysX provides a complete optimization package which allows developers to optimize their games for maximum performance. This includes GPU acceleration, multi-threading, and data streaming.
Conclusion
NVIDIA PhysX is a powerful physics engine which enables real-time physics in leading edge PC and console games. PhysX software is widely adopted by over 150 games and is used by more than 10,000 developers. PhysX is designed specifically for hardware acceleration by powerful processors with hundreds of cores. PhysX features include rigid body simulation, character controller, soft body simulation, fluid simulation, particle system, collision detection, constraint solver, behavioral simulation, cloth and hair simulation, and optimization.
NVIDIA PhysX can provide realistic and immersive physics-based simulations and effects in gaming.